Mine just arrived. It is super light, glass is crisp and clear, illumination gets overpowering towards max setting. Overall, first impressions are positive.

Some pictures. Turrets are really nice, takes just enough effort to turn where they probably won’t be bumped but they’re capped too. Illumination has a divider for night/day setting, parallax down to 20-infinity.
